Transaction 17526c5393665e036e777a9a762bf76f34bd2eb2bbb123ebdb0a5e36cec4eaac
1 Input
1 Output
-
17526c5393665e036e777a9a762bf76f34bd2eb2bbb123ebdb0a5e36cec4eaac:0
- value
- 485379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34646f415f2980b93abfa5d7aa452927cfdb6e3c OP_EQUAL
- address
- 36U3NqUpfhovG4h8P4TzYSEXMShuF93bJf